State of Minnesota

INTRODUCTION OF BILLS

H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ES

Wednesday, May 02, 2001


The following House Files were introduced:

Smith introduced:

H. F. No. 2503, A bill for an act relating to civil actions; regulating the liability of employees of educational entities; proposing coding for new law in Minnesota Statutes, chapter 121A.

The bill was read for the first time and referred to the Committee on Education Policy

Gerlach; Anderson, B.; Krinkie and Erickson introduced:

H. F. No. 2504, A bill for an act relating to public employees; requiring public employees to fund a portion of the cost of state-paid annual premiums due to rising health insurance costs; amending Minnesota Statutes 2000, sections 43A.18, by adding a subdivision; 43A.22; 43A.24; 43A.28; 43A.30, subdivision 1, by adding a subdivision.

The bill was read for the first time and referred to the Committee on Governmental Operations and Veterans Affairs Policy

Seifert introduced:

H. F. No. 2505, A bill for an act relating to redistricting; adopting a congressional redistricting plan for use in 2002 and thereafter; amending Minnesota Statutes 2000, section 2.031, subdivision 2; repealing Minnesota Statutes 2000, sections 2.742; 2.752; 2.762; 2.772; 2.782; 2.792; 2.802; 2.812.

The bill was read for the first time and referred to the Committee on Redistricting
